Goldblum to replace Rickman in Seminar
JURASSIC PARK star JEFF GOLDBLUM is to replace ALAN RICKMAN in hit Broadway play SEMINAR.
Rickman, who has received rave reviews for his latest theatrical role - as an international literary great-turned-teacher, will leave the show after a final performance on 1 April (12). He has led the cast since the drama opened last year (Nov11).
Goldblum will take over from 3 April (12) for an eight-week engagement. He last appeared on Broadway in The Pillowman in 2005, according to BroadwayWorld.com.
He has wowed theatre critics and fans in London in recent years, starring opposite Kevin Spacey in The Old Vic productions Speed-the-Plow and The Prisoner of Second Avenue.
